Obituary

It is with deep sadness and heavy heart that we let the world know that our beloved son, brother, uncle, nephew, and grandson has gone on to heaven to be with his Papa Mac. God welcomed his precious child, Lane, home on Tuesday, December 23rd, 2014. He was 27 years old.

Lane was born in Ventura, CA. on April 27, 1987 to Vicki and Lane Hannigan. He attended Loma Vista Elementary, Anacapa Middle School and Beuna High School.

Lane held various jobs in his short life. He worked for a short time as Host, Waiter and Prep cook in his Grandmother's restaurant at the Vagabond Coffee Shop and loved making different concoctions in the kitchen. He also worked as desk clerk at the Vagabond Inn. He was employed at one time at Longs Drug in Ventura. And he was a great help to his Dad in his plumbing business, Hannigan Plumbing.

Lane was a fun loving guy who had many, many interests. He loved to skateboard, ride his bike, go to the beach, have family barbeque's, play with his nephew, Zack and just "kick it" with his friends. He was an avid, die-hard fan of the New England Patriots and loved to watch the games on tv with his family and friends. He enjoyed making music on his computer, going to rock concerts when he could, loved going out to restaurants and having good food, (but, did not like mustard or avocado). He was full of life and enjoyed helping others. Since he was just a big kid himself, he loved children and always had so much fun just being around them and playing with them - especially all his little nieces and nephews.

Lane had a big, generous heart and would help anyone in need with whatever he could. No job, to him, was too big or too small. He was a sensitive, caring guy who truly cared about the welfare of others. He had so many, many friends that really cared about him as well. From really well-to-do friends, to middle class, down to ones who live on the street, young or old, it did not matter to him. They were his friends and he cared for them all quietly.

He had struggled with addiction in the past, and up to the time of his death was making great strides in over-coming that addiction. He was attending drug classes, going to NA meetings, working with his Dad and trying to get jobs at several companies around town. He had made up his mind that he was really going to make it this time because he wanted a different kind of life for himself.

Our world will be a much sadder place without him in it and he will be missed forever by his family and friends that he leaves behind.

Lane is survived by his Mother, Vicki Hannigan, his Father, Lane and second mother, Wendi. He leaves behind his brothers Zachary Fields, Dylan Fields, and Nickolas Hannigan. His sister Kim Dickson and husband Garrett, Grandparents Jolene McBee, Paul and Sherry Hannigan, nephews Zack Fields, Owen & Wyatt Dickson, Neices; Lily, Emmy and Addy Dickson and numerous aunts, uncles and cousins, whom he loved dearly.

He was preceded in death by his loving (Papa) Mac Mcbee of Ventura, Ken Barnett of Pensylvaina, and his Nona, Gay Riva of Ventura.
